Is it illegal to bulldoze cemeteries in Missouri?

http://www.marshallnews.com/story/1810896.html

Look over halfway down the page-paragraph 12 or so. It's interesting-talks about how there were a few cemeteries of possible historical significance in Saline County that were bulldozed. In one cemetery the headstones were buried and in another they were used to line a creek bed. I believe I know which one is buried-I used to hang out there growing up and look at the headstones.

I never thought of someone doing something like this. Is it illegal?
